Baltimore and Buenos Aires street artists team up for an exchange program to explore the roots and cultural identities which shape our communities. This cultural exchange program consists of a two-part collaboration between Section1 (Baltimore) and BA Street Art (Buenos Aires) – two organizations that support the urban art scene in both cities. Part one is a group show entitled “Roots-Raices”, to be hosted in partnership with Gallery 788. Paintings from 14 artists will be on display, seven from Buenos Aires and seven from Baltimore.
Curators:
Richard Best and Alex French of Section 1 are curating the artworks by the Baltimore artists while Matt Fox-Tucker, director of BA Street Art is curating works by the artists from Buenos Aires.
Artists:
From Argentina: Alfredo Segatori, El Marian, Luxor, Primo (Nicolas Germani and Sasha Reisin), PatxiMazzoni Alonso and Ice.
From Baltimore: Gaia, Pablo Machioli, Paul Mericle, Lee Nowell-Wilson, Ernest Shaw, CheLove, MasPaz, Michael Owen, Billy...Mode, Nether, HKS 181 and Gregg Deal.
